Vitazyme on Wheat – 2010-Chile

These four Chilean wheat trials proved that only one Vitazyme application, at either 1.0 or 1.5 liters/ha, applied early in the growing season, was necessary to provoke yield increases (5 to 6%). Two 1.5 liter/ha applications, one early and one later, also increased the yield (3%). On average, reducing fertilizer N also brought a yield reduction, so under these Chilean conditions the ability of Vitazyme to improve N efficacy was inhibited by certain soil factors. These factors could relate to soil microbiology, soil organic matter, compaction, or other factors.
